Hello,
I am new to Audi (hopefully this will be a better experience than BMW 750Li).
I just purchased a black 2012 A8L with 55k miles. It comes with Executive Seating Package and I feel the car is literally computer on wheels (OMG all the buttons and options!)
Anyway, the car however did not come with Owners manual which I will probably have to get on ebay.
So my first question is how do you import songs into the Audi Jukebox? I put an audio CD in the DVD drive in the front dash (I also tried the DVD changer in the glove compartment), the CD played fine but when I tried to import, all my import sources options were greyed out. Maybe Audi is different because in my previous 2007 Lexus 460LS, you simply insert the audio CD and press the "record" button
Also, any special requirement when the time comes to replace the car battery? I remember from my days of owning a BMW 7 series that one must 'recalibrate' after changing the car battery.
Sorry for the long post, I'll hold up on further questions for now....
Thanks

Welcome.

Go onto Audi USA web site for online manuals. You cannot download, but they do display very nicely on a tablet. The MMI and music functions are in a separate manual. Here: Audi Online Owner's Manual You just need your VIN. Any relevant VIN actually works if you want to read one by grabbing a VIN off an Autotrader or similar ad. While at it, check for any outstanding recalls here: Audi Recall Services by Vehicle Identification Number

Yes, battery needs to be coded to car...in theory. From D3 experience, you can just put in a new battery from any brand that fits and then change prior serial number by one digit if you have VCDS. A fair number of us think if you just drive it for a while, system figures out battery is new/has different electrical charge and capacity characteristics that it is always monitoring.

Welcome to the forum and congratulations on the new A8! About importing to Jukebox, I too tried in vain to import from a CD. A little research revealed that Audi does not allow that due to "copyright laws". Why Audi worries about it while other manufactures don't is up for debate.

What does work is downloading music to an SD card and importing to Jukebox. Others on here will tell you what formats work, but I always use MP3. I think AAC work with your year also. Hope this helps!

If you have VCDS or know someone who does, CD ripping can be enabled. See my signature for that, and a number of the other basic mods available.
